SPURIOUS SCATTERING OF 6.2 Gev PROTONS IN NUCLEAR EMULSIONS

Multiple scattering measurements of 6.2 Bev proton tracks in emulsion were made for cell lengths up to 10,000 microns. It was found that the spurious scattering contribution remained constant for cell lengths greater than about 5000 microns. Measurements on a group of parallel tracks showed that the region of the microscopic dislocations responsible for spurious scattering had dimensions on the order of 1 to 2 mm. (auth)
